Retailers who have received a notice of an alleged violation from the Arkansas Tobacco Control Board shall be subject to either criminal or civil penalties or fines of up to $250 for a first violation within 48 months of the notice, a fine of up to $500 and suspension of license for up to two (2) days for the second violation within 48 months, a fine of up to $1,000 and suspension of license for up to seven (7) days for a third violation within 48 months, a fine of up to $2,000 and suspension of license for up to 14 days for a fourth or subsequent violation within 48 months and a fine of up to $2,000 and a possible license revocation for a fifth (5) violation within 48 months
